Temporary Receptionist & Administrative Assistant
Top Benefits
About the role
Are you ready to suit up?
The GardaWorld Winnipeg Branch is looking for its next Temporary Full-Time Receptionist & Administrative Support team member. As the first point of contact for all employees and visitors, you’ll play a key role in creating a welcoming and professional environment while supporting day-to-day administrative operations.
This is a temporary role until January 15, 2025 (possible extension).
What’s in it for you:
- Monday to Friday schedule (8:00 a.m. – 4:00 p.m.)
- $18.00 per hour
- Safe and inclusive work environment
- Paid on-the-job training
- Ongoing development and advancement opportunities
What you’ll do:
- Greet and assist all visitors in a professional, courteous manner.
- Handle incoming calls, direct inquiries, and take messages as needed.
- Maintain visitor access and office security procedures (logbooks, screening, and authorization checks).
- Keep internal directories and distribution lists updated.
- Manage incoming and outgoing mail and courier deliveries.
- Maintain organized and accurate employee filing systems.
- Order and maintain office supplies and stationery.
- Support uniform management — ordering, tracking, and outfitting security staff.
- Ensure the reception and entry areas remain clean and organized.
- Assist with administrative tasks such as photocopying, filing, and document sorting.
- Complete other administrative duties as assigned by the branch management team.
What you bring:
- Previous experience in a fast-paced receptionist or administrative role.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ills (both written and verbal).
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office and other office software.
- Excellent organization, time management, and problem-solving skills.
- Ability to multi-task and adapt in a dynamic environment.
- Physical ability to lift up to 50 lbs and move uniforms or supplies as needed.
- Professional appearance and demeanor.
